ICAI launches a separate website for its disciplinary function / mechanism
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I) has launched a separate website for its disciplinary function.
The digitisation of disciplinary function of the ICAI is a welcome step. The said portal separately deals with disciplinary mechanism and contains following information
1. Disciplinary Mechanism including its three limbs namely Director (Discipline), Board of Discipline (the Board) and Disciplinary Committee (The committee) and the procedures adopted by them in carrying out disciplinary functions.
2. Details of meetings held by the Board and the Committee (March 2020 onwards)
3. Relevant Acts, Rules and Regulations
4. Code of ethics – Existing Code of Ethics 2009, Code of Ethics, 2019 Volume-I applicable w.e.f. 1.7.2020 and Code of Ethics, 2020 Volume-III applicable w.e.f. 1.7.2020
5. Cause Lists and Orders of the Board and the Committee – Currently orders/reports of the committee are available from FY 2015-16 onwards.
6. The portal also contains the provision for filing online complaint.
